"Vaccination" is a vaccine given by injection. Vaccination is an effective means to prevent infectious diseases caused by certain pathogenic microorganisms (such as bacteria, rickettsia, viruses, etc.).

Humans have used various vaccines to control the spread of diseases to the greatest extent possible. For example, the smallpox virus was basically eradicated after the emergence of the cowpox vaccine.

Depending on the type of vaccination, the injection site is different. Most common injections are on the arm, but there are exceptions such as on the buttocks and head.
